About Atsushi Sato
Atsushi Sato is a scholar working on Polymers and Plastics, Renewable Energy, Sustainability and the Environment and Electrical and Electronic Engineering, having authored 7 papers that have together received 382 indexed citations. Recurring topics across this work include Perovskite Materials and Applications (3 papers), Conducting polymers and applications (3 papers) and Advanced Photocatalysis Techniques (3 papers). The work is most often cited by research in Polymers and Plastics (228 citations), Electrical and Electronic Engineering (371 citations) and Materials Chemistry (153 citations). Atsushi Sato has collaborated with scholars based in Japan and India. Frequent co-authors include Kazuhiro Marumoto, Keisuke Tajima, Kazuhiro Matsuda, Minh Anh Truong, Shuaifeng Hu, Richard Murdey, Kyohei Nakano, Yoshihiko Kanemitsu, Kento Otsuka and Tomoya Nakamura. Their work appears in journals such as Energy & Environmental Science, International Journal of Hydrogen Energy and Solar Energy Materials and Solar Cells.
